Yellowfin tuna, cooked leads 6–2 · 8 categories decided · 2 ties

Both foods compared at 100 kcal.

The verdict

Yellowfin tuna, cooked comes out ahead, winning 6 of 8 nutrient match-ups.

Pick Whole egg, raw for more calcium and more iron.

Pick Yellowfin tuna, cooked for more protein, less sugar, less saturated fat, less sodium, more potassium and more magnesium.

Evenly matched on fiber and vitamin C.
